感谢您的反馈!
图片搜索接口
名称 | 类型 | 是否必须 | 示例值 | 更多限制 | 描述 |
---|---|---|---|---|---|
app_signature | String | 必须 | asdasdasdsa | API signature | |
fields | String | 可选 | commission_rate,sale_price | 请求字段 | |
image_file_bytes | byte[] | 必须 | [11,1,1] |
图片文件字节数组,最大不超过 100 KB
支持的文件类型: |
|
img_cid | String | 可选 | 88888888 | 图片类目倾向,不填则为最佳匹配。0 - 服装;3 - 包;4 - 鞋子;88888888 - 其他类目 | |
media_user_id | String | 可选 | 00111 | 媒体用户唯一识别号 | |
product_cnt | Number | 可选 | 50 | 搜索结果数量,最高 50 | |
shpt_to | String | 可选 | US | ship-to 国家 | |
sort | String | 可选 | LAST_VOLUME_ASC | 排序方式:SALE_PRICE_ASC, SALE_PRICE_DESC,LAST_VOLUME_ASC, LAST_VOLUME_DESC | |
target_currency | String | 可选 | USD | 目标币种:USD, GBP, CAD, EUR, UAH, MXN,TRY, RUB, BRL, AUD, INR, JPY, IDR, SEK,KRW | |
target_language | String | 可选 | en | 目标语言:en,ru,pt,es,fr,id,it,th,ja,ar,vi,tr,de,he,ko,nl,pl,mx,cl,iw,in | |
tracking_id | String | 可选 | test | 媒体 trackingid |
名称 | 类型 | 示例值 | 描述 |
---|---|---|---|
result | Response | result | 默认描述 |
|
TaobaoClient client = new DefaultTaobaoClient(url, appkey, secret); AliexpressAffiliateImageSearchRequest req = new AliexpressAffiliateImageSearchRequest(); req.setAppSignature("asdasdasdsa"); req.setFields("commission_rate,sale_price"); req.setImageFileBytes(new FileItem("/tmp/file.txt")); req.setImgCid("88888888"); req.setMediaUserId("00111"); req.setProductCnt(50L); req.setShptTo("US"); req.setSort("LAST_VOLUME_ASC"); req.setTargetCurrency("USD"); req.setTargetLanguage("en"); req.setTrackingId("test"); AliexpressAffiliateImageSearchResponse rsp = client.execute(req); System.out.println(rsp.getBody());
<aliexpress_affiliate_image_search_response> <result> <code>123</code> <data> <products> <product> <sale_price>100</sale_price> <sale_price_currency>USD</sale_price_currency> <original_price>200</original_price> <original_price_currency>USD</original_price_currency> <app_sale_price>88</app_sale_price> <app_sale_price_currency>USD</app_sale_price_currency> <target_sale_price>100</target_sale_price> <target_sale_price_currency>USD</target_sale_price_currency> <target_original_price>200</target_original_price> <target_original_price_currency>USD</target_original_price_currency> <target_app_sale_price>88</target_app_sale_price> <target_app_sale_price_currency>USD</target_app_sale_price_currency> <discount>1%</discount> <evaluate_rate>89%</evaluate_rate> <first_level_category_id>111</first_level_category_id> <first_level_category_name>服饰</first_level_category_name> <second_level_category_id>66</second_level_category_id> <second_level_category_name>鞋子</second_level_category_name> <lastest_volume>1111</lastest_volume> <product_detail_url>https://xxxx.html</product_detail_url> <product_id>1111</product_id> <product_main_image_url>https://xxxx.html</product_main_image_url> <product_small_image_urls> <string>https://xxxx.html</string> </product_small_image_urls> <shop_id>1</shop_id> <shop_url>https://xxxx.html</shop_url> <promotion_link>http://s.click.aliexpress.com/e/xxxxx</promotion_link> <commision_rate>3%</commision_rate> <hot_product_commission_rate>3%</hot_product_commission_rate> <platform_product_type>TMALL</platform_product_type> <relevant_market_commission_rate>3%</relevant_market_commission_rate> <promo_code_info> <promo_code>3SDK13</promo_code> <code_campaigntype>1</code_campaigntype> <code_value>On order over USD 10, get USD 7 off On order over USD 10, GET 5% off</code_value> <code_availabletime_start>2020/04/01 0:00</code_availabletime_start> <code_availabletime_end>2020/04/30 23:59</code_availabletime_end> <code_mini_spend>20</code_mini_spend> <code_quantity>111</code_quantity> <code_promotionurl>https://s.click.aliexpress.com/e/_bB8gdV</code_promotionurl> </promo_code_info> <product_title>HUAWEI Watch</product_title> <product_video_url>www.aliexpress.com/test.mp4</product_video_url> </product> </products> <total_record_count>1111</total_record_count> <region> <pos_top_left_x>100</pos_top_left_x> <pos_top_left_y>100</pos_top_left_y> <pos_bottom_right_x>100</pos_bottom_right_x> <pos_bottom_right_y>100</pos_bottom_right_y> </region> </data> <message>success</message> <success>true</success> </result> </aliexpress_affiliate_image_search_response>
<error_response> <code>50</code> <msg>Remote service error</msg> <sub_code>isv.invalid-parameter</sub_code> <sub_msg>非法参数</sub_msg> </error_response>
错误码 | 错误描述 | 解决方案 |
---|